Movie review: In 'Bloodshot,' Vin Diesel glowers and growls as a bionic assassin
Movie review: In 'Bloodshot,' Vin Diesel glowers and growls as a bionic assassin
03-12-2020 04:32 AM In "Bloodshot," former elite U.S. commando Ray Garrison, played by Vin Diesel, dies before the opening credits. He then wakes up on a hospital gurney inside a gleaming skyscraper to find that his body has been donated by the military to science -- specifically the firm Rising Spirit Technologies, whose founder Dr. Emil Harting (Guy Pearce, sporting a bionic arm, two-day stubble and an untrustworthy twinkle in his eye) has resuscitated Ray, turning him into a cybernetically enhanced super-soldier.
